The i9 and i7 are both high-performance processor lines from Intel, but they cater to different needs and offer distinct features. Here’s a brief comparison:

Intel Core i7:

– Typically offers 6-8 cores and 12-16 threads
– High-performance for gaming, content creation, and heavy multitasking
– Hyper-Threading technology for improved multithreading
– Generally more affordable than i9 processors
– Suitable for most users who need a powerful processor for demanding tasks

Intel Core i9:

– Offers 8-18 cores and 16-36 threads
– Extreme performance for:
– Professional content creators (video editing, 3D modeling)
– Heavy data processing and analytics
– Extreme gaming and streaming
– Higher Turbo Boost frequencies for increased single-thread performance
– Supports more PCIe lanes and memory channels for enhanced expandability
– Generally more expensive than i7 processors
– Ideal for professionals and enthusiasts who require the absolute best performance

Key differences:

– Core count: i9 typically offers more cores and threads than i7
– Performance: i9 provides higher Turbo Boost frequencies and better multithreading capabilities
– Price: i9 processors are generally more expensive than i7 processors
– Use case: i9 is suited for extreme workloads and professional applications, while i7 is suitable for most high-performance needs

Remember, the specific differences between i9 and i7 processors can vary depending on the generation and model. Always check the specifications and benchmarks for the particular processor you’re interested in.
